Helical gears are a type of gear that has teeth that are cut at an angle. This angle allows the teeth to engage each other gradually and smoothly, which reduces noise and vibration. Helical gears are often used in high-speed applications, such as in automotive differentials.

Helical gears are made of a variety of materials, including steel, cast iron, and aluminum. The material of the gear will depend on the specific application and the environment in which it will be used.

Key Factors for Selecting a Helical Gearbox

Choosing the right helical gearbox for an application involves considering several key factors:

  • Load and Torque: Evaluate the maximum load and torque requirements to ensure the gearbox can handle the application’s demands.
  • Speed Range: Determine the required speed range and ensure the gearbox’s gear ratios can accommodate it.
  • Efficiency: Helical gearboxes are known for their high efficiency. Select a gearbox with efficiency ratings that meet your application’s needs.
  • Space Constraints: Consider the available installation space and choose a compact gearbox that fits within the available dimensions.
  • Mounting Position: The mounting position affects lubrication, cooling, and overall performance. Ensure the gearbox is suitable for the desired mounting orientation.
  • Service Life: Choose a gearbox with a service life that matches your application’s expected lifespan.
  • Backlash: Evaluate the allowable backlash, which affects precision and positioning accuracy.
  • Noise and Vibration: Assess the acceptable noise and vibration levels and choose a gearbox with suitable characteristics.
  • Environmental Conditions: Consider factors like temperature, humidity, and dust levels to ensure the gearbox can operate reliably in the application environment.
  • Maintenance: Factor in maintenance requirements and choose a gearbox with manageable maintenance needs.
  • Cost: Balance performance with budget constraints to find a gearbox that offers the best value for your application.

By carefully evaluating these factors, you can select a helical gearbox that optimally meets your application’s requirements and ensures efficient and reliable operation.

Relationship Between Helix Angle and Load Capacity in Helical Gears

The helix angle of helical gears plays a significant role in determining their load-carrying capacity and overall performance. Here’s the relationship between the helix angle and load capacity:

1. Load Distribution: The helix angle affects how the load is distributed along the gear teeth. A larger helix angle results in a more gradual tooth engagement, allowing for smoother load sharing across multiple teeth. This improves the gear’s ability to handle higher loads.

2. Contact Ratio: The contact ratio, which indicates the number of teeth in contact at any given time, increases with a larger helix angle. A higher contact ratio helps distribute the load over a larger area of the gear teeth, enhancing load-carrying capacity.

3. Tooth Meshing: The helix angle affects how the teeth mesh with each other. A higher helix angle promotes gradual and smoother meshing, reducing the concentration of stress on individual teeth. This results in improved resistance to wear and fatigue.

4. Axial Thrust: Helical gears produce axial thrust due to their helical nature. This thrust can affect the gear’s ability to handle radial loads. Proper consideration of the helix angle can help manage axial thrust and prevent overloading.

5. Lubrication: The helix angle affects the lubrication conditions between gear teeth. A larger helix angle may allow better oil flow and lubrication, reducing friction and wear, thereby enhancing load capacity.

6. Noise and Vibration: The helix angle also influences noise and vibration levels in helical gears. Optimal helix angle selection can minimize noise and vibration, contributing to smoother operation and prolonged gear life.

Optimal Helix Angle Selection: While a larger helix angle generally increases load capacity, it’s important to strike a balance. Extremely large helix angles can lead to reduced tooth strength and efficiency. Engineers consider factors like application requirements, tooth strength, and noise considerations when selecting the optimal helix angle for a specific gear design.

The relationship between the helix angle and load capacity underscores the importance of proper gear design to ensure optimal performance, durability, and reliability in various applications.

Limitations and Disadvantages of Helical Gear Systems

While helical gear systems offer numerous advantages, they also come with certain limitations and disadvantages:

  • Axial Thrust: Helical gears generate axial thrust due to the helix angle of the teeth. This thrust can cause additional load on bearings and may require additional measures to counteract.
  • Complex Manufacturing: The manufacturing process for helical gears is more complex than that of straight-toothed gears, which can lead to higher production costs.
  • Axial Length: Helical gears require more axial space compared to spur gears with the same gear ratio. This can be a limitation in applications with space constraints.
  • Sliding Contact: Helical gears have sliding contact between their teeth, which can result in higher friction and more heat generation compared to rolling contact gears.
  • Efficiency: Although helical gears are generally efficient, their efficiency can be slightly lower than that of some other gear types, especially at high speeds.
  • Complexity in Gearbox Design: The inclination of helical gear teeth introduces additional complexity in gearbox design and alignment.
  • Reverse Thrust: In some cases, reverse thrust can occur when helical gears are subjected to high axial loads, leading to undesirable effects.

It’s important to consider these limitations and disadvantages when selecting gear systems for specific applications. Despite these challenges, helical gears remain a popular choice in various industries due to their benefits and overall performance characteristics.
